| Category / Metric | Sandy | West Valley City |
|---|---|---|
| Financial Overview | ||
| Median Income | $108,926 | $80,889 |
| Unemployment Rate | 3% | 3% |
| Housing Market | ||
| Median Home Price | $637,800 | $480,000 |
| Price per SqFt | $244 | $217 |
| Monthly Rent (1BR) | $1,301 | $1,301 |
| Housing Cost Index | 118.6 | 118.6 |
| Cost of Living | ||
| Groceries Index | 93.0 | 93.0 |
| Gas Price (Gallon) | $3.40 | $3.40 |
| Safety & Lifestyle | ||
| Violent Crime (per 100k) | 178.0 | 345.0 |
| Bachelor's Degree+ | 37% | 15% |
| Air Quality (AQI) | 112 | 110 |
Both cities have a similar cost of living (within 5%).
You could earn significantly more in Sandy (+35% median income).
Sandy has a significantly lower violent crime rate (48% lower).
